The model shows an oval four-story timber building in St. Georgen, built in just four weeks. The building's stability completely relies on solid cross-laminated timber walls, without a concrete core. The calculations in RFEM were done by Isenmann Ingenieur GmbH. The clients are EGT Energie GmbH, while Ketterer Architekten and Holzbau Bendler are other project partners. Sustainability and energy efficiency are the focus here.
